    Summary of reviews

    The reviews present a mixed but coherent portrait of Rosecrans Care Center. Strengths cited repeatedly include a caring clinical team, a strong rehabilitation program, and an active social-services/admissions presence. Many families praised individual nurses, CNAs, the rehab team (PT/OT/Speech), and specific staff members in housekeeping and front-desk roles. The facility’s activity calendar—holiday events, religious services, daily social-area programming, and therapeutic activities—was frequently noted as engaging and beneficial to residents’ recovery and well-being. Dining quality is often described positively, with generous portions and tasty meals contributing to a hotel-like, family-oriented atmosphere in many areas of the building.

    At the same time, reviews identify several operational weaknesses that prospective families should consider. There is a notable pattern of inconsistent clinical responsiveness: some families experienced prompt, attentive care and proactive updates, while others described delays in medication administration, slow response times to care needs, and variability in staff communication tone. Related to clinical care, there are serious individual allegations concerning wound management and infection outcomes; these raise concerns about wound-care protocols and infection-prevention practices and warrant targeted questions during a visit.

    Safety and equipment maintenance emerge as another mixed area. While some reviewers praised fall-risk management and successful rehabilitation outcomes, others described falls and problems with mobility equipment, indicating potential gaps in transfer-safety processes and preventive equipment oversight. Facility maintenance and cleanliness are generally viewed positively at the building level—many reviewers called the environment clean and well-maintained—but there are inconsistent reports about room-level cleaning, occasional water/heating issues, and variable housekeeping thoroughness across units.

    Communication and administrative responsiveness also show variability. Several families highlighted strong social-work involvement, helpful admission assistance, and proactive family updates; conversely, others reported lapses in post-hospitalization follow-up or difficulties getting timely information. Language barriers and inconsistent staff availability were mentioned as impairing some resident interactions. Activity programming is widely regarded as a strength, though a few comments suggest noise-management could be improved during certain events.

    In summary, Rosecrans Care Center demonstrates clear strengths in rehabilitation, engagement programming, and many aspects of day-to-day resident support, with individual staff frequently singled out for compassionate care. However, recurring operational concerns—particularly inconsistent clinical responsiveness, wound-care and infection-prevention gaps, equipment and transfer-safety issues, and variability in room-level maintenance and communication—suggest areas for further inquiry. Families considering this facility should tour in person, ask about wound-care protocols, staffing ratios and shift coverage, medication administration procedures, equipment-maintenance practices, and policies for post-hospitalization communication to better understand how the facility addresses the variability noted across reviews.

    About Rosecrans Care Center

    Rosecrans Care Center stands as a well-kept healthcare facility that offers rehabilitation, nursing care, and assisted living, and there are dedicated wings for skilled nursing and rehabilitation services where residents can recover from surgery or manage long-term health problems in a clean, bright environment, and the rooms open up to cheerful activity spaces and an outdoor patio where annual events like a luau take place, while the kitchen sends the warm smell of fresh meals drifting through the halls every day. Nurses and care staff spend an average of 1.54 hours per resident each day, including 0.63 hours from Registered Nurses, 0.91 from LPNs, and 2.59 from CNAs, and the nurse-to-patient ratio helps residents get personalized attention and treatment plans tailored for recovery, long-term care, or Alzheimer's support, while a team of social workers gives help with information, family needs, and discharge planning. The staff is also trained for medically complex care, and therapy programs are made to fit the individual, giving people a chance to regain skills or adjust to new needs, and respite stay options are available.

    The building keeps residents safe with a full sprinkler system, security guards, event security, and mobile and plain clothes patrols. Rosecrans Care Center maintains a 92% occupancy rate, with 99 certified beds and space for 91 residents, though there are 113 Skilled Nursing Facility beds in total as reported. They take part in Medicare and Medicaid, and they're a for-profit organization, but they're not part of a hospital or a big group of nursing homes, nor are they a continuing care retirement community or a special focus facility. There are both resident and family councils, and a social services team is there for help with planning and requests. Amenities include a variety of common areas, activity rooms, dining rooms, and bright communal spaces, plus special activities are matched to each person's abilities, and friendly staff lead social programs.

    About health quality, 25% of short-stay residents have had pressure sores, and 4% experience moderate to severe pain, but there are no reports of short-stay delirium. Vaccination rates for short-stay folks are lower, with 43% getting the pneumococcal and 48% the influenza shot, but long-term residents have higher rates-63% for flu and 74% for pneumococcal vaccination. Among long-stay residents, 7% have lost weight, 5% have had a urinary tract infection, and 4% have worsened movement ability; 8% spend most of the day in bed or chair, while 2% have a catheter in place, and 63% of low-risk residents lose bowel or bladder control. Two percent are more depressed or anxious, and 19% are physically restrained. Long-stay folks also have an 8% rate of needing daily living help, 2% have moderate to severe pain, and 22% have pressure sores. The center has received some deficiencies, mainly around food safety and resident rights, but these caused only minimal or potential harm.
